SEO, GEO & SEM Platform Market: AI Visibility Depends on Who Writes About Your Brand

Zusammenfassung des Signals

AI-generated answers are becoming a distinct discovery channel with different citation signals than traditional Google rankings. Multiple studies and vendor experiments (BrightEdge, Moz, Muck Rack, Semrush, Ahrefs) show large gaps between pages that rank in Google’s organic top 10 and sources cited by AI Overviews or chat-based engines: independent editorial coverage and bylined author entities are strongly favored. The article recommends treating earned media as infrastructure (lead with the claim, use named credentialed authors, maintain steady distributed placements, refresh quarterly) and measuring "citation share" across AI engines (ChatGPT, Google AI Mode/Gemini, Claude, Perplexity) to track where buyers actually find brand recommendations. The piece frames the May 2026 Google core update and the rise of AI Mode/AI Overviews as evidence that marketers must add AI citation tracking to SEO and PR workflows.

Shows a structural shift in search discovery: AI-driven citation behavior diverges from traditional organic rankings, meaning marketers must change measurement and PR/SEO tactics; the article references Google’s May 2026 update and platform-level AI features that materially affect visibility.

Wichtigste Kernpunkte & Evidenz

  • BrightEdge found about 16.5% overlap between sources cited in Google AI Overviews and pages ranking in Google’s organic top 10 for the same queries.
  • Moz’s analysis of 40,000 AI Mode queries found 88% of AI citations came from pages outside the organic top 10.
  • Muck Rack’s Generative Pulse study (May) analyzed over 25 million links and reported earned media accounts for 84% of AI citations and journalism for 27% of cited sources.
  • A Semrush experiment tracking 81 pages over 30 days reported Google AI Mode cited 36% of new content within 24 hours (falling to 26% by day 30); ChatGPT cited 8% on day one and 42% by day 30.
  • Ahrefs data indicates websites with author schema are nearly three times as likely to appear in AI answers.
